Output 8bd5f761ae1e2ada3449f30f1054cea00bc985119f7cf7f2e7b42ab4d74c752a:0

value
12203889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91b59e958f156c26786b70bd1dbc6c86f11579a4 OP_EQUAL
address
3EyTUW266VDMbMjNyApGpSeW5nLBBt3QqN
transaction
8bd5f761ae1e2ada3449f30f1054cea00bc985119f7cf7f2e7b42ab4d74c752a
spent
true